As award season comes to a close, what better day than April Fool's for a satirical take on awards shows? The Emu Awards will have no categories, very few rules and a slightly-less-than-serious attitude. 

Bring us your best unselected concept, your strongest unpublished campaign or your uncommissioned masterpiece of design, illustration or photography. Voting will be done by your peers/attendees on the spot and winners will receive ... something really bitchin'.

So here's the deal. Just mount your entries on a board of any dimension (that doesn't require a forklift). Bring as many as you like, or can afford to enter. We will hang them and supply you with a carefully-determined amount of voting stickers. The entry with the most votes wins. How those votes are earned ... well let's just say aggressive lobbying, bribes or blackmail will not be frowned upon. But neither will honest hard work.

So dig out what may be some of your best work and join us for the inaugural Emus. We plan for this to be our biggest fundraiser for 2009 so your attendance is mandatory. No fooling.

Cheap beer and deviled eggs will be provided.
